Implementing Figure 11.2 Matching Exercises
To effectively implement matching activities using Figure 11.2, follow these systematic steps:
Step 1: Analyze the Figure
Begin by thoroughly examining Figure 11.Still, 2 to identify all components, elements, and relationships. Note any labels, colors, symbols, or organizational structures that will be relevant to the matching exercise.
Step 2: Define Learning Objectives
Determine what specific knowledge or skills students should gain from the matching activity. Clear objectives guide the creation of appropriate matches and assessment criteria.
Step 3: Create the Matching Pairs
Develop a comprehensive set of matching items based on Figure 11.2. confirm that:
- Matches are unambiguous and have only one correct answer
- Distractors (incorrect options) are plausible but clearly distinguishable
- The exercise covers the key elements of the figure
- Matches align with the learning objectives
Step 4: Design the Exercise Format
Choose the most appropriate matching format based on the figure's content and learning objectives. Consider whether a traditional list format, a drag-and-drop digital format, or a hands-on card activity would be most effective. Nothing fancy.
Step 5: Implement the Activity
Introduce the matching exercise to students, providing clear instructions and adequate time for completion. Consider whether students should work individually, in pairs, or in small groups, depending on the learning objectives.
Step 6: Review and Discuss
After completion, review the answers as a class or group discussion. This reinforcement step helps solidify understanding and address any misconceptions that may have emerged during the activity.

Common Challenges and Solutions
When implementing matching activities with Figure 11.2, educators may encounter several challenges:
Challenge 1: Limited Figure Complexity
Solution: If Figure 11.2 is relatively simple, consider having students:
- Add their own annotations
- Create additional related figures
- Develop matching questions that connect the figure to broader concepts
Challenge 2: Difficulty in Distinguishing Elements
Solution: For figures with similar components:
- Provide additional context or clues
- Use color-coding in the matching activity
- Include visual aids to highlight distinguishing features
Challenge 3: Student Disengagement
Solution: To maintain interest:
- Incorporate real-world applications
- Add competitive elements (like team challenges)
- Connect the activity to students' personal interests or experiences
